Plain-English summary
Precision Agriculture Research, Education, and Information Dissemination Act of 1996 - Amends the Competitive, Special, and Facilities Research Grant Act to emphasize competitive grants that promote precision agriculture (as defined by this Act) research projects and to promote dissemination of such projects' results.
Provides for the establishment of multistate and national agriculture partnerships, including existing partnerships between national laboratories (Secretary of Energy) and the Department of Agriculture.
Amends the Federal Agriculture Improvement and Reform Act of 1996 to include precision agriculture within the research categories of the Fund for Rural America.
